![]() In a second stage, we validated this list. ![]() The selection process was double blinded. We combined the two lists to identify the Triple Aim measures that can be calculated based on the IMA-data. In parallel, we analysed the list of available data in the IMA-database. To do this, we used the list of Triple Aim measures from the systematic review of Hendrikx et al. Theory/Methods: In a first stage, we created a list of “Triple Aim Claims Indicators” (TACI). As such the IMA database is very useful to picture healthcare related processes and trajectories, but also to create accurate proxy parameters for a range of patient conditions (Vaes et al., 2018). This database contains all the claims for the compulsory health insurance in Belgium including doctor and hospital visits, technical interventions and drug deliveries. ![]() One of the most important routine health databases in Belgium is the Inter Mutualistic Agency (IMA) database. To make evaluation sustainable in the long term and limit registration workload, we will evaluate if relevant Triple Aim measures can be calculated based on claims data, which are already systematically collected. Triple Aim is used as evaluation framework: improving the health of populations, patient experience of care and reducing the per capita cost of healthcare (Stiefel & Nolan, 2012). Introduction: In Belgium, 12 integrated care pilot projects (Integreo) have been started in beginning 2018. ![]()
